Swiss Company Formation - A Comprehensive Guide
Introduction
Welcome to Eli Swiss, your trusted partner for Swiss company formation. If you are a doctor, own a medical center, or are a dermatologist looking to establish your business in Switzerland, you’ve come to the right place. In this guide, we will provide you with a comprehensive overview of the process and benefits of forming a company in Switzerland, including the steps involved, legal requirements, and more. Let’s dive in!
Why Choose Switzerland for Your Business?
Switzerland has long been recognized as a global business hub, renowned for its stability, strong economy, and favorable business environment. Here are some of the key reasons why Switzerland is an ideal location for your company formation:
1. Political and Economic Stability
Switzerland boasts a long-standing tradition of political neutrality and stability, making it an attractive destination for both local and international businesses. The Swiss economy is known for its robustness and resilience, providing a secure foundation for your company's growth and success.
2. Highly Skilled Workforce
One of Switzerland's greatest strengths lies in its well-educated and highly skilled workforce. With a strong focus on innovation and research, Switzerland offers access to a pool of talented professionals to help drive your business forward.
3. Favorable Tax System
Switzerland has a competitive tax system that offers various benefits to businesses. Its corporate tax rates are among the lowest in Europe, and the country has an extensive network of double taxation treaties, ensuring that your company can operate internationally with ease, while benefiting from favorable tax provisions.
4. Excellent Infrastructure
Switzerland's modern infrastructure, including well-developed transportation networks, advanced telecommunications, and state-of-the-art facilities, creates an environment conducive to business growth and enables efficient operations.
5. Proximity to European Markets
Located in the heart of Europe, Switzerland provides excellent access to European markets. With its central location and well-established trade agreements, your company can easily reach a vast customer base and benefit from the continent's economic opportunities.
The Process of Swiss Company Formation
Now that we've highlighted the advantages of choosing Switzerland for your business venture, let's dive into the process of company formation:
1. Define Your Business Structure
Before proceeding with the company formation process, it's crucial to determine the most suitable structure for your business. Depending on your specific needs and goals, you can choose between various options such as sole proprietorship, partnership, limited liability company (LLC), or corporation. Each structure has its own legal requirements and implications, so it's essential to consult with legal and business professionals to make an informed decision.
2. Choose a Business Name
Selecting a unique and memorable business name is an important step in the formation process. It should reflect your company's values, services, and industry while complying with Swiss naming regulations. Ensure the chosen name is available and not already registered by another company.
3. Prepare the Necessary Documentation
Gathering the required documentation is a critical step in the company formation process. This typically includes drafting the articles of association, shareholders' agreement (if applicable), and any other supporting documents mandated by the Swiss authorities. Be sure to adhere to the legal guidelines and seek professional advice to ensure compliance.
4. Appoint a Registered Agent
Swiss law requires companies to have a registered agent who can represent the business in legal and administrative matters. The registered agent must be based in Switzerland and should be authorized to act on behalf of the company.
5. Submit the Application
With all the necessary documentation in order, it's time to submit your company formation application to the appropriate Swiss authorities. The application process may vary depending on your chosen business structure and canton (Swiss administrative region) of registration. Working with a reputable company formation service like Eli Swiss can streamline this process and ensure the accurate submission of documents.
6. Meeting Legal Requirements
During the company formation process, it is crucial to meet all legal requirements, such as registering for VAT (Value Added Tax) if applicable, obtaining necessary licenses and permits, and adhering to employment laws. Complying with these legal obligations is essential to operate your business smoothly and avoid any penalties.
7. Open a Bank Account
Once your company is successfully registered, opening a Swiss bank account is highly recommended. Swiss banks are renowned for their stability, privacy, and excellent banking services. You'll have access to a wide range of financial tools and a dedicated account manager to support your company's financial needs.
Benefits of Swiss Company Formation
Swiss company formation offers numerous advantages that can contribute to the long-term success and growth of your business. Let's explore some of the key benefits:
1. International Reputation
Establishing a company in Switzerland instantly boosts your business's international reputation. The country's political stability, exceptional quality standards, and strong rule of law create a trustworthy image that can resonate with both clients and investors.
2. Access to Swiss Markets
By forming a company in Switzerland, you gain access to local Swiss markets, renowned for their high purchasing power and strong consumer demand. This can provide a solid foundation for your business, helping you tap into a rich customer base and achieve sustainable growth.
3. Network and Collaboration Opportunities
Switzerland is home to many thriving industries, research institutions, and international organizations. By establishing your company in Switzerland, you'll have the opportunity to connect and collaborate with like-minded professionals, fostering innovation and growth.
4. Tax Optimization
Switzerland's favorable tax system allows for effective tax planning and optimization, supporting your business's financial stability. With low corporate tax rates, attractive tax deductions, and the possibility of accessing double taxation treaties, you can maximize your company's profits and reinvest in its development.
5. Business Flexibility
Swiss regulations provide flexibility for businesses, allowing you to adapt your company's structure and activities to evolving market demands. This flexibility gives you the freedom to explore new opportunities, expand your services, or even relocate your business within Switzerland if necessary.
6. Protection of Intellectual Property
Switzerland is renowned for its strong protection of intellectual property rights. By forming your company here, you can secure your inventions, trademarks, and copyrights, ensuring that your innovative ideas are safeguarded and your business can thrive.
Conclusion
Congratulations on taking the first step towards Swiss company formation! In this comprehensive guide, we've explored the benefits and process of establishing a business in Switzerland for doctors, medical centers, and dermatologists. From the country's stability and skilled workforce to its favorable tax system and excellent infrastructure, Switzerland provides an optimal environment for your company's success. Remember to consult with experts like Eli Swiss to navigate the complexities of company formation and ensure compliance with legal requirements. Get in touch with us today and experience the numerous advantages of running your business in Switzerland.
Disclaimer: The information provided in this article is for general informational purposes only and does not constitute legal, financial, or professional advice. Consult with qualified professionals for personalized guidance regarding your specific business requirements.